The Jean Meltzer – The Eight Heartbreaks of Hannukah – December 1, 7 pm

https://www.showpass.com/jean-meltzer-the-eight-heartbreaks-of-hanukkah-2/

Celebrate the Season with Jean Meltzer and The Eight Heartbreaks of Hanukkah
Bestselling author Jean Meltzer returns with a sparkling new holiday rom-com that blends love, laughter, and Jewish tradition. The Eight Heartbreaks of Hanukkah follows a struggling songwriter facing past heartbreaks and rediscovering hope—just in time for the Festival of Lights.  With her signature warmth and charm, Meltzer offers an unforgettable evening of storytelling, humor, and heart. Expect laughter, insight, and a touch of holiday magic.

     Jack Fairweather – The Prosecutor – December 11, 7pm

St. Louis County Library – Clark Family Branch, 1640 S Lindbergh Blvd, St. Louis

FREE https://www.showpass.com/jack-fairweather-the-prosecutor/

Dive into the incredible history of Fritz Bauer, a gay, Jewish judge from Stuttgart who survived the Nazis and made it his mission to force his countrymen to confront their complicity in the genocide.

In The Prosecutor: One Man’s Battle to Bring Nazis to Justice, award-winning journalist Jack Fairweather brings to life the extraordinary journey of Bauer whose moral clarity and tireless pursuit of justice helped shape the postwar world.
